Jonathan P. Keeler, 58, of Lima, passed away on Wednesday, October 1, 2025 at St. Rita’s Medical Center. He was born on September 19, 1967.
He graduated from Kalamazoo College. After a year of teaching, he worked at Applebee’s and became a District Manager and eventually found a love for finance and began his career working at car dealerships. He was working as the finance manager at Reineke Family Dealerships. He enjoyed golfing and traveling with his wife, especially to Cherokee, NC. He also enjoyed watching football, especially the Michigan State Spartans and the Detroit Lions. He had a love for his pets and was an avid supporter of his daughter Brooke’s pet and people food pantry in Toledo.
He is survived by his wife: Anissa Keeler, mother: Janice Keeler, children: Brooke (Andrew) Winkelman, Bryce Carson, and Alexandra (Will) Blasius, granddaughter: Logan Blasius, brother: Michael (Sherri) Keeler, and sisters: Marti (Kyle) Scates and Kat Barber.
Family will receive friends on Sunday, October 5, 2025 from 2-5 p.m. at Chamberlain-Huckeriede Funeral Home, Lima, Ohio.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Paws & People Pantry in Toledo, Ohio, which was started by his daughter, Brooke.
